About the Role
Lead the development and deployment of production-grade machine learning systems, focusing on computer vision and vision-language models for fraud detection and luxury item verification, while establishing foundational infrastructure across the ML lifecycle.
Responsibilities
- Collaborate with operations and data science teams to advance machine learning and retrieval-augmented generation prototypes into reliable, scalable production systems.
- Deploy and optimize high-compute computer vision and vision-language models to strengthen trust, safety, and authentication processes.
- Establish end-to-end ML infrastructure, including data and feature management, model tracking, registry, serving, and monitoring systems.
- Automate retraining pipelines to support variable deployment frequencies across use cases such as fraud detection and recommendation systems.
- Develop robust multi-model architectures and assess cost and complexity trade-offs between internal tools and enterprise platforms.
- Serve as a founding member in shaping the ML engineering practice, defining technical standards and scalability frameworks.
- Evolve into a central role providing cross-functional ML infrastructure support and mentorship across domains like search, discovery, pricing, marketing, and data platforms.
